You are a good candidate for buth Thermage and Refirme at your age.
You are a good candidate for either Thermage or Refirme at your age.
They both use Radiofrequency energy to heat the deep dermis while sparing the surface of the skin. Thermage monopolar, Refirme bipolar.
Thermage treatment takes 90-120 minutes and the pain factor is moderate.The improvement is gradual(4-6 monthsor longer), although some patients see more rapid improvement. Some patients need a second treatment after 6 months.
